The state of Alabama has some of the highest rates of cervical cancer in the USA. The Alabama Department of Public Health, University of Alabama at Birmingham and TogetHER for Health are collaborating with the goal of eliminating the disease in the state.
When Linda was diagnosed with cervical cancer she says she was uneducated about the disease and how to prevent it.
Linda now works for the Alabama Department of Public Health in outreach, educating women about the importance of vaccination and cervical screenings. Linda shares her journey from patient to advocate in 'Conquering Cervical Cancer USA.'
